Global geothermal industry passes 12,000 MW operational

Green Car Congress

The global geothermal industry surpassed 12,000 MW of geothermal power operational, with about 600 MW of new geothermal power coming online globally, according to a year-end update by the Geothermal Energy Association (GEA). In Nevada, NV Energy is looking to replace coal plants with 300 MW of renewable energy, including geothermal.

Evidence from glacier ice: Until it was banned, leaded gasoline dominated the anthropogenic lead emissions in South America

Green Car Congress

Leaded gasoline was a larger emission source of the toxic heavy metal lead than mining in South America, even though the extraction of metals from the region’s mines historically released huge quantities of lead into the environment, according to a study by researchers from the Paul Scherrer Institute PSI and the University of Bern.

MIT and IEA reports take different views of the future of natural gas in transportation

Green Car Congress

MIT and the IEA both have newly released reports exploring the potential for and impact of a major expansion in global usage of natural gas, given the current re-evaluation of global supplies. Globally, natural gas vehicles are a small fraction, on the order of 1%, of the close to 900 million vehicles in the vehicle parc.

PwC analysis finds meeting 2 C warming target would require “unprecedented and sustained” reductions over four decades

Green Car Congress

PwC analysis finds a need for global carbon intensity to drop an average of 5.1% Since 2000, the global rate of decarbonization has averaged 0.8%; from 2010 to 2011, global carbon intensity fell by just 0.7%.
